Talk Title

Lorentz symmetry violation in neutrinos in curved spacetime and its consequences

Abstract

The neutrino propagating in curved spacetimes, e.g. around black holes, in early curved universe, violates Lorentz and then CPT symmetry, at least in the local coordinate. In this talk, first I will recall, based on my works in last seven years, how do the Lorentz and CPT violation arise through Dirac equation in curved spacetime: it is due to coupling of spin of the neutrino to background spin connection. Then I will address the modified dispersion relation and how does the neutrino asymmetry arise and then neutrino oscillation probability get affected as a consequence of this.
